The Cancer-Testis lncRNA LINC01977 Promotes HCC Progression by Interacting With RBM39 To Prevent Notch2 Ubiquitination
Investigators discovered a novel CT-lncRNA, LINC01977, based on the Genotype-Tissue Expression and The Cancer Genome Atlas databases. LINC01977 was exclusively expressed in testes and highly expressed in HCC.
[EMBO Journal] Using a variety of in vitro and in vivo techniques, researchers showed that metastatic prostate cancer cells acquire a specific Na+/Ca2+ signature required for persistent invasion.
[Molecular Cell] Investigators explored the role of minor intron-containing genes and minor spliceosome in cancer, taking prostate cancer as an exemplar.
[Nature Communications] The authors uncovered dual-phosphorylated form of sterol regulatory element-binding protein 1 (SREBF1), pY673/951-SREBF1 that acts as an androgen sensor, and dissociates from androgen receptor in androgen deficient environment, followed by nuclear translocation.
